ROUTINE INSPECTION
A joint routine inspection was conducted on this date with G. Stiehr, REHS, and J. Luces, REHS. This report was generated by J. Luces
11 reported violations
- K05: Hands clean, properly washed; gloves used properly
Observed a food worker pick an object off of the ground, touch a garbage can, and subsequently resume food preparation. [CA] Properly wash hands with soap, warm water and dry using single use paper towels as required prior to putting on gloves. [COS] The food worker was directed to stop their task, remove their gloves, and wash their hands at the hand washing sink.
- K23: No rodents, insects, birds, or animals
1. Observed live fruit flies throughout the bar and back warewashing areas. 2. Observed dead adult cockroaches on the floors in the corners of the hard to reach areas below the bar. No evidence of live cockroach activity was observed at this time. It was discussed with the owner that a monthly pest control service is performed. [CA] Food facility shall be kept free of cockroaches and non-disease carrying insects, weevils, ants, gnats, and fruit flies.
- K33: Nonfood contact surfaces clean
Remove/clean the accumulation of grime from the non-food contact surfaces of the ice machines. [CA] Nonfood-contact surfaces of equipment shall be kept free of an accumulation of dust, dirt, food residue, and other debris.

- K07: Proper hot and cold holding temperaturesCritical
Measured one container of mashed potatoes between 124F - 140F at the steam table, double stacked in an additional metal insert, and one container of meat sauce between 121F - 146F. The person in charge stated the items were heated on the stove and placed in the unit less than 1 hour prior. [CA] PHFs shall be held at 135F while hot holding. [COS] The violation was corrected by reheating the above items to above 165F.
